Raleigh Capital Management Inc. decreased its holdings in Marriott International, Inc. (NASDAQ:MAR - Free Report) by 86.8%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 230 shares of the company's stock after selling 1,515 shares during the quarter. Raleigh Capital Management Inc.'s holdings in Marriott International were worth $55,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Marriott International (NASDAQ:MAR -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, May 6th. The company reported $2.32 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.25 by $0.07. Marriott International had a negative return on equity of 100.64% and a net margin of 9.75%. The business had revenue of $6.26 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$6.19 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$2.13 earnings per share. The firm's revenue was up 4.8% on a year-over-year basis. Analysts forecast that Marriott International, Inc. will post 10.1 earnings per share for the current year.

Marriott International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, June 30th. Stockholders of record on Friday, May 23rd were issued a $0.67 dividend. This is a boost from Marriott International's previous quarterly dividend of $0.63. This represents a $2.68 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 0.95%. The ex-dividend date was Friday, May 23rd. Marriott International's dividend payout ratio is presently 30.52%.

Marriott International Company Profile

(Free Report)

Marriott International, Inc engages in operating, franchising, and licensing hotel, residential, timeshare, and other lodging properties worldwide.
